java中linkedhashmap
为您找到以下相关答案
java 中 Linked HashMap 怎么添加元素?
1 public static void main(String[] args) 2 { 3 LinkedHashMap<String, String> linkedHashMap = 4 new LinkedHashMap<String, String>(); 5 linkedHashMap.put("111", "111"); 6 linkedHashMap.put("222", "222"
Java 如何对 HashMap 进行排序?
publicclassLinkedHashMapDemo{publicstaticvoidmain(String[]args){//Map<String, String> map = new HashMap<String, String>();LinkedHashM...
通过索引获取 LinkedHashMap 的值?解决方案与最佳实践 - 百 ...
一、通过键直接获取值(基础方法)LinkedHashMap 本质是键值对集合,可通过 get(key) 方法直接获取值:LinkedHashMap<String, ChargeType> map = new LinkedHashMap<>()...
20,谈谈LinkedHashMap和HashMap的区别(重点)
除了具有HashMap的所有特性外,还采用了一个双向链表(Linked双向链表)来保存节点的访问顺序或插入顺序。双向链表保证了LinkedHashMap的有序性,可以根据节点的访问顺序或插入...
java - 将 LinkedHashMap 转换为复杂对象 - Segment...
objectMapper 的使用有助于将 LinkedHashMap 转换为相应的 DTO 对象 ObjectMapper mapper = new ObjectMapper(); List<DriverLocationDTO> driverlocationsList = mapper.convertValue(respon...
Java中为何报错:java.util.LinkedHashMap cannot be...
在Java开发中,经常会遇到类似“java.util.LinkedHashMap cannot be cast to class com.telecomjs.crm.agreement”的错误。这是因为LinkedHashMap...
在Java中如何使用LinkedHashMap保持映射顺序
在Java中,使用LinkedHashMap保持映射顺序的核心是通过其双向链表机制维护插入或访问顺序。以下是具体实现方法和关键点说明:1. 保持插入顺序(默认行为)原理:LinkedHashMap...
Java HashMap和LinkedHashMap在遍历顺序上有什么差异 - 百度...
选择LinkedHashMap的情况:需要输出顺序与插入顺序一致,如配置项、日志记录、序列化等。需要实现LRU缓存,此时需设置accessOrder=true。总结HashMap:无序,遍历顺序不可预测...
Java LinkedHashMap排序机制如何实现? - 编程语言 - CSDN...
本篇文章将深入探讨两个重要的数据结构实现类:Collection和Map,以及它们在Java中的应用。 首先,Collection是Java集合...
Java之LinkedHashMap - 百度经验
本文为你简单介绍Java中的LinkedHashMap。方法/步骤 1 LinkedHashMap是HashMap的一个子类,它的用法与父类HashMap相同。不过LinkedHashMap比HashMap多了一个特点,那就是可以按照添加元素时的顺序来进行遍历。完整代码如图所示。2 LinkedHashMap遍历效率较高,插入、删除效率较低。不过,LinkedHashMap遍历的速度一般比HashMap慢,LinkedHashMap的遍历速度与实际数据有关,HashMap的...